Surimi Kanikama. Surimi is almost tasteless and can therefore take on any flavor you want. Different types of seasonings, additives, and binders are also added to the paste. Kanikama (also called surimi) imitates more expensive crab in texture and taste. Surimi is a paste made from ground varieties of fish to make the imitation crab meat taste! Often shortened as kani, kanimaka is made of surimi (or white fish paste). Surimi is the paste made from whitefish and can be used in various different ways to flavor each kamaboko fish cake differently. The main ingredient in kanikama is usually surimi, which is a paste made from pulverized fish meat, typically from white fish like pollock, hake, or whiting. Kanikama, more commonly known as kani, are sticks of imitation crab made from something called surimi. Those surimi sticks or crab sticks are actually called kanikama. Read about this interesting item & how it is made and used. The surimi is mixed with other additives such as starch, egg whites, salt, and flavorings to mimic the taste, texture, and color of crab meat. Imitation crab is a key ingredient in california sushi rolls, along with avocado and cucumber, and is used as a crab substitute in. Kanikama is the imitation or fake crab meat produced from surimi paste that is made by grinding various species of white fish (mostly alaska pollock). Imitation crab meat is distinctive for its bright red or orange color.
